Cervical stenosis means that the space around the spinal cord and nerve roots in the neck has narrowed. Arthritis, disc degeneration, bone spurs, thickened ligaments, a herniated disc, or alignment changes can all contribute. Some people have manageable pain for years. Others develop weakness, numbness, clumsy hands, or signs of spinal cord compression that require prompt specialist evaluation.
The right path depends on your symptoms, neurological exam, imaging, the number of levels involved, spinal alignment, and whether the spinal cord is under pressure. A thoughtful plan should be individualized, not based on a one-size-fits-all preference for therapy, injections, fusion, or disc replacement.
When Cervical Stenosis Needs Urgent Attention
Not every MRI finding requires surgery. Many adults have some narrowing without severe symptoms, and imaging must always be interpreted alongside how a person feels and functions. However, cervical myelopathy – spinal cord dysfunction caused by compression – deserves special attention because it can progress.
Seek timely medical evaluation for worsening hand weakness or loss of dexterity, difficulty with buttons or handwriting, unsteady walking, repeated falls, new leg stiffness, or changes in bowel or bladder control. Sudden weakness, severe loss of coordination, or new bladder or bowel symptoms should be treated as urgent. Delaying care when the spinal cord is compromised can reduce the chance of a full neurological recovery.
A cervical spine specialist will typically review MRI or CT images, assess reflexes, strength, sensation, gait, and hand coordination, and determine whether symptoms are coming from a nerve root, the spinal cord, or another condition entirely.
Best Options for Cervical Stenosis: Start With the Diagnosis
The best treatment is often determined by the pattern of stenosis. A single soft disc pressing on one nerve may call for a very different approach than multilevel narrowing caused by arthritis and bone spurs. Likewise, a patient with arm pain but normal strength and no cord compression has different priorities than someone with progressive myelopathy.
Conservative care can be appropriate when symptoms are mild, stable, and there is no concerning neurological deficit. When there is significant spinal cord compression, progressive weakness, or pain that has not responded to well-directed non-surgical care, surgery may offer the clearest way to create space for the nerves or cord.
Non-surgical treatment for mild or stable symptoms
For selected patients, a physician may recommend anti-inflammatory medication, short-term pain medication, physical therapy, posture and activity modification, or a carefully supervised exercise program. The goal is to reduce irritation, maintain strength, and help the neck move comfortably without provoking symptoms.
Epidural steroid injections or selective nerve-root injections may help certain patients with arm pain caused by nerve inflammation. They can be useful diagnostically as well as therapeutically. Still, injections do not remove bone spurs or permanently enlarge a narrowed spinal canal. They are generally not a substitute for decompression when spinal cord pressure is causing myelopathy.
Physical therapy also has limits. High-force neck manipulation is not appropriate for everyone with cervical stenosis, particularly when there is spinal cord compression or neurological decline. A program should be guided by a qualified clinician who understands the imaging and the patient’s symptoms.
Surgical Options That Relieve Compression
When surgery is recommended, the primary objective is decompression: removing the disc, bone spur, ligament, or other structure that is crowding the nerve roots or spinal cord. The reconstruction chosen afterward depends on stability, alignment, anatomy, and the level of degeneration.
Anterior cervical discectomy and fusion
Anterior cervical discectomy and fusion, often called ACDF, is one of the most established surgeries for cervical stenosis caused by disc disease or bone spurs at the front of the spine. The surgeon reaches the neck from the front, removes the problematic disc and compressive material, and places a graft or implant that allows the bones to fuse.
Fusion can be an excellent choice when there is instability, marked degeneration, deformity, multiple severely diseased levels, or anatomy that makes motion preservation unsuitable. It provides reliable decompression and stabilization. The trade-off is that the treated segment no longer moves. For some patients, that change is barely noticeable; for others, particularly those with active lifestyles or adjacent-level degeneration, preserving motion may be worth exploring.
Cervical artificial disc replacement
Cervical artificial disc replacement also begins with removal of the diseased disc and decompression of the nerves or spinal cord. Instead of fusing the level, the surgeon places an artificial disc designed to maintain controlled motion.
For properly selected patients, disc replacement may preserve movement at the treated level and may reduce stress on neighboring discs compared with fusion. It is often an appealing option for adults who want to return to work, travel, exercise, and daily activities with as much natural neck movement as possible.
It is not the right choice for every case. Severe facet joint arthritis, significant instability, osteoporosis, major deformity, extensive bone spur formation, or certain multilevel patterns may favor fusion or another approach. The quality of the decompression and the accuracy of patient selection matter more than choosing the newest-sounding implant.
Posterior decompression procedures
When stenosis affects several levels or compression is primarily behind the spinal cord, surgeons may consider a posterior approach from the back of the neck. A laminectomy removes part of the bone to make additional room. In some cases, it is paired with fusion to maintain stability. Laminoplasty is another motion-sparing procedure that reshapes and opens the bony canal rather than removing it entirely.
These operations can be highly effective for multilevel cervical stenosis, but the best approach depends heavily on neck alignment. Patients with a forward-curved or kyphotic neck may not benefit from a posterior-only strategy in the same way as those with preserved alignment. This is why detailed imaging review is essential before deciding on a procedure.
How to Compare Fusion and Motion Preservation
The fusion-versus-disc-replacement decision is often framed too simply. Fusion is not a failure, and artificial disc replacement is not automatically superior. Both can be excellent operations in the right hands.
A useful discussion with a spine surgeon should cover the source of compression, how many levels are involved, the condition of the facet joints, spinal stability, bone health, and your goals for mobility. It should also include the practical questions: What recovery restrictions should I expect? What symptoms are most likely to improve? What are the risks of waiting? And what would make the surgical plan change once the surgeon reviews updated imaging?
